Yishen Tongluo Fang (YSTLF) is a traditional Chinese medicine (TCM) herbal formula developed by Professor Sun Zixue at the Henan Provincial Hospital of Traditional Chinese Medicine. Composed of multiple herbs including *Salvia miltiorrhiza* (Danshen) and *Cuscuta australis* (Tu Si Zi), the formula is designed to "tonify the kidney and clear collaterals" to address the TCM syndrome of kidney deficiency and blood stasis. It is clinically utilized for the treatment of diabetic kidney disease (DKD), male infertility (specifically oligoasthenozoospermia), and diabetic erectile dysfunction. Research indicates that YSTLF exerts its therapeutic effects by regulating the Sirt6/TGF-β1/Smad2/3 signaling pathway, modulating mitochondrial dysfunction, reducing inflammation and apoptosis, and repairing sperm DNA damage. It is typically administered orally as a decoction or in granule form.
